Transporters/Drivers:
We would like to offer HUGE thanks Travis Kjemperud, and Heather Bare, for the endless
miles they travel on I-5, picking up and delivering dogs. These two troopers are ready to
go on a moment's notice. They have traveled as far North as Bothell Washington, along
the coast, and many places in between.
Travis and Heather do home visits, deliver dogs to their new homes, and pickup dogs
needing rescued. They drop off Shepherds at vet appointments, as well as pick them up.
These are two, tireless, young people. Without their help we would not be able to keep up
with all the requests we receive.
